I've been trying to put a list of the most common playstyles there are for MMO gamers and this is what I have come up with so far.

  • Collector - This is the person who tries to collect all of something; whether it is all the "rare" pets in a game, rare suits of armor, etc. If it can be put on a checklist, they want it.
  • Completionist - This is the person that has to do it all even if it doesn't really benefit them anymore; such as finishing "green” quests or doing a dungeon crawl just because they have never visited that area even if it won’t obtain them any tangible benefits.
  • Crafter - This is the person who wants to create things more than anything else.
  • Explorer - This is the person who wants to see the world; every little nook and cranny.
  • Ganker - Not a PvPer but someone who likes to kill other players when there is almost no chance for the ganker to lose.
  • Helper – This is the person who is always online helping others finish their quests, getting them gear, even if it doesn't benefit them at all.
  • Hunter – This is the person who lives for the hunt; looking for a worthy target that can give them a challenge. Unlike the PvPer, a Hunter will hunt down and purse their opponent, waiting for the right moment to ambush or strike.
  • Leader – This is the person who is always organizing others; whether it is groups, raids, or entire guilds.
  • Loremaster - Unlike a roleplayer, a loremaster does not "get into character" often in game; instead they just love to learn the lore and backstory of the game.
  • Master Looter – This is the person who desires virtual items and will run a dungeon crawl hundreds of times just to get that one particular item.
  • Powergamer - This is the person who has to "win" the game in the fastest time possible. To them, fun is in winning and the path is just a means to an end.
  • PvPer - PvPers live to compete; they continually want to test their skills against other living, breathing and most importantly, skilled opponents.
  • Raider - This is the person who loves to do dungeon crawls.
  • Reroller – This is the person that tries out a variety of different character types and has a hard time sticking to just one character.
  • Roleplayer - This is the person who creates a persona within the game and truly tries to live like that individual while in the confines of the game.
  • Socializer - This is the person who, more than anything, just wants to hang out with their friends and make new ones.
  • Theorycraft – Tries to determine the “best” way to build a character.

Granted, some people would fit into multiple categories. If one appears to be missing, please let me know. Or if there is a better name (or terminology) for an existing one, let me know that too.

You missed one.

The Merchant: This person strives to make a name for him/her self by offering premium crafted goods and/or services. In addition, this person also develops a reputation for being one of the wealthiest characters on the server.

Every MMO I have played has had one of these guys.

SWG - A guy named Thompson started the South Coronet Mall, he made his fortune by renting out vendor space (there were over 100 unique vendors at it's peak). He was also one the best crafters on the server.

EQ2 - A guy named Woodknot had several master tradeskillers and sold the servers best items from his home. He was a true "platinum baron".

WoW - A guy named Eyes started "Eyes Brand" goods and services. He offers everything - for a price. He even has his own slogan, "have you seen Eyes today?"

The Merchant player type differs from the "crafter" category as many that fall into that category strive to make the best items for their own use or for guildies, not necessarily for fortune and fame.

I fall into the Merchant category, however, I have never reached the level of fame and fortune as the players listed above.
